Minnesota Timberwolves vs. Denver Nuggets Game 1 Preview: Starting Lineups Tonight, Betting Tips and Game Prediction (April 18) | 2026 NBA Playoffs


The Minnesota Timberwolves and Denver Nuggets lock horns in Game 1 of the first-round series at the Ball Arena on Saturday, with tipoff at 3:30 p.m. ET. The Timberwolves finished the regular season in sixth place in the Western Conference standings with a 49-33 record, while the Nuggets finished in third place with a 54-28 record.

The two teams matched up four times in the regular season, with the Nuggets winning the season series 3-1. In the most recent matchup on March 1, the Timberwolves won 117-108.

Minnesota Timberwolves vs. Denver Nuggets Preview

The Timberwolves’ biggest concern heading into Game 1 is the health of Anthony Edwards. The superstar guard is listed as questionable with a right knee injury. Minnesota not only needs Edwards on the floor but also at his best, as he is capable of taking over the game with his aggressive scoring and fiery presence.

Ball control will be crucial for the Timberwolves. They must limit turnovers, as gifting easy scoring opportunities to Denver could prove costly. Defensively, Rudy Gobert and Julius Randle will have to step up against Nikola Jokic, forcing the Serbian star into difficult jumpers rather than allowing easy looks at the rim.

On the other side, the Nuggets’ offense revolves heavily around Jokic. He will look to pull Gobert out of the paint, creating driving lanes for Jamal Murray and others. Murray thrives in big moments and has established himself as one of the most clutch performers in recent playoff history.

If Murray finds his rhythm from beyond the arc, Minnesota could be in serious trouble. Denver will also need contributions from its bench to ease the burden on Jokic, Murray, and Aaron Gordon. Players like Tim Hardaway Jr., Jonas Valanciunas and Bruce Brown must step up and make a meaningful impact.
